Failure: the Key to Success

How do you view failure? Do you see it as something negative that you don't want to be associated with or do you see it as something positive? Most people in the world fear failure.


Fear of failure is the main reason why more than 80% of people in the world are not prepared to change their circumstances. Why do people fear failure so much? The reason for this is because people don't understand the dynamics involved in success and failure.


What successful people do that unsuccessful people don’t is take chances, huge risk even. Every time you take a risk, you hope it will be a huge success, but sometimes, it might not turn out the way you hoped. But instead of thinking this is a dirty word, consider how much you could grow if you learned huge lessons from every failure.


Understanding this is important because it puts failure in its proper perspective and removes the fear around it.

My husband and I failed many times during our journey to learn real estate, we made mistakes and trusted people that cost us a great deal of money. But we never let it get us down, instead, we learned from our mistake and moved on. This ability to bounce back, learn then use that to pivot, is what led us to our successful path today. Resilience is KEY!

It’s important to understand the dynamics of failure and how valuable it can be in your personal growth. When someone doesn’t understand this and meets with temporary failure they give up thinking that they aren’t capable or that they will never reach their goals. But is this really what it is? Does the fact that you didn't make it the first time mean that you are not good enough? Does it mean that you'll never make it? Not at all! All it means is YOU HAVE NOT FOUND THE CORRECT PATH YET!


So what do you do next? You go back and try to find out where you went wrong. Then you try again but this time learning from went wrong the previous time. When this doesn't work you go back and look at everything you have done so far. Talk to successful people who have made it in this area. Think of what you might have left out and try again.

"Every failure, every adversity and every heartache, carries with it the seed of an equivalent or a greater benefit", says author and mentor to many great men, Napoleon Hill. Failure contains the seed of victory and of success.

Failure teaches you what works and what doesn't. Failure teaches you resilience which is a key to becoming a successful person. When you study the reasons for your failure and learn from it, you'll find the key to your success.

The great inventor Thomas Edison knew this truth better than anyone else. It took Edison 8000 trials to perfect the Edison battery? Afterwards he uttered this famous quote, "At least we know 8000 things that don't work".

You should also be like that. Every successful person has had to overcome temporary defeat at one time or another. Know this! You haven't really failed until you ACCEPT defeat. Do you envy those who got success easily? Don't! Success earned in spite of earlier failure is so much sweeter than if you would get it otherwise.


Those who earn success in this way know the road to success. They are not afraid of losing what they have because they have learned how to become successful. Those that easily get success don't know the road to success through hardships, which opens them up to greater failure later.


Let temporary defeat no longer be an obstacle. You have many hidden talents, but let resilience and the ability to learn from failure be your super-power to success and realizing your dreams. Don’t let the fear of failure scare you into complacency, let failure be something that drives you toward success. Failure is an ally because it contains the seed of success.
